For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 164 students in Floyd School District. This district's average elementary testing ranking is 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public elementary schools in New Mexico.
Public Elementary Schools in Floyd School District have an average math proficiency score of 26% (versus the New Mexico public elementary school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 33% (versus the 34%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 63%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the New Mexico public elementary school average of 81%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$13,933 in this school district is less than the state median of $15,100. The school district revenue/student has declined by 18%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$14,665 is higher than the state median of $14,450. The school district spending/student has declined by 7% over four school years.
